PM Oli and RAW Chief Goel held talks: PM’s Press Advisor



KATHMANDU: Chief of Reseach and Analysis Wing (RAW), the external Intelligene Agency of India, Samant Kumar Goel has held a meeting with Prime Minister KP Sharma Oli during his recent visit to Nepal.

RAW Chief Goel came to Nepal on Wednesday to take stock of the security condition of Nepal prior to the Nepal visit of Indian Chief of Army Staff (CoAS)  Manoj Mukund Naravane.

Four-star general of the Indian Army, Naravane is coming to Nepal on November 3 to receive the honorary tile of the Nepal Army.

RAW Chief Goel met with Prime Minister KP Oli at Baluwatar on Wednesday evening according to Surya Thapa, the press advisor to the Prime Minister.

Goel in the meeting with Prime Minister Oli expressed his comments to maintain the age-old fridenly ties between the two countries, to resolve the border issues through dialogues and to give continuity to the mutual bilateral cooperation, said Thapa.

However, Thapa did not disclose what the Prime Minister said during the meeting.

Goel has returned home on Thursday morning, wrapping up his two-day visit to Nepal.
